- Otto SherrillMar 13, 2025 · 4 months agoWhen calculating the benchmark index for cryptocurrencies, several factors are considered. These factors include the market capitalization of the cryptocurrencies included in the index, the liquidity of the cryptocurrencies, the trading volume, and the price volatility. The market capitalization reflects the overall value of the cryptocurrencies in the index, while liquidity and trading volume indicate the ease of buying and selling these cryptocurrencies. Price volatility measures the fluctuations in the prices of the cryptocurrencies. These factors are used to determine the weightage of each cryptocurrency in the index, which in turn affects the overall index value. Higher market capitalization, liquidity, trading volume, and lower price volatility generally result in a higher weightage and a larger impact on the index value.
- Imran AnsariFeb 05, 2025 · 5 months agoCalculating the benchmark index for cryptocurrencies involves considering various factors. These factors include the size and popularity of the cryptocurrencies, the trading activity, and the stability of the prices. The size and popularity of the cryptocurrencies play a significant role in determining their weightage in the index. Higher trading activity indicates a more active market for the cryptocurrencies, while price stability ensures a more reliable index value. Additionally, factors like the inclusion criteria, rebalancing frequency, and the methodology used for calculating the index also influence the final benchmark index value. It is important to note that different benchmark indexes may have different factors and methodologies, so it's essential to understand the specific index being referred to.
